Brunei Travel Guide

The small sultanate of Brunei is certainly not a must-see destination, but I recommend anyone to spend a few days there in case they intend to visit the island of Borneo. In fact, if you decide to travel by land it is an almost forced stop to get from one part of Malaysian Borneo to the other.

Philippines Travel Guide

The Philippines is a tropical paradise in Southeast Asia comprising over 7,000 islands. They are known for breathtaking beaches, crystal clear waters, some of the best diving sites in the world, and the hospitality of the people with whom it is really easy to communicate since English is one of the official languages. The country also has a rich history and culture influenced by its Spanish colonial past.
